Packaging Cost Supplier Guide: What Drives Price
Pricing starts with the material, and material changes more than most buyers expect. A 350gsm C1S artboard for folding cartons behaves very differently from an ECT-32 corrugated board used for shipping boxes, especially once you factor in humidity, stacking strength, and how the board folds on high-speed equipment. Add a soft-touch coating, foil stamp, and a custom insert, and unit cost can move fast. A good packaging cost supplier guide should help buyers see that supplier markup is only one part of the equation, because paperboard mills in Guangdong and corrugated plants in Jiangsu price material by grade, basis weight, and yield, not by how polished the sales deck looks.
The biggest drivers are straightforward: material grade, box style, print complexity, finishing, insert requirements, and freight weight. A rigid box with wrapped chipboard costs more than a simple folding carton because it uses more board, more glue, and more manual assembly time at the wrapping station. A custom printed box with full coverage ink costs more than a one-color logo on white stock because every square inch of print adds setup, drying, and quality risk. That is basic manufacturing math, even if it sometimes gets dressed up in sales language that sounds fancier than it is. In a factory in Dongguan, I watched a line of 12 workers spend nearly 45 minutes on a small run of hand-wrapped lid-and-base boxes, and the labor cost showed up exactly where you would expect it to: in the quote.
Small design choices have a larger effect than most new buyers realize. Reduce board thickness from 24pt to 18pt, and material expense can drop while crush resistance changes with it. Simplify a die line, and the tooling quote can fall. Remove a window cutout or embossing detail, and labor on the line often drops too. In one supplier negotiation I handled for a cosmetics client in Los Angeles, moving from a five-panel structure to a standard tuck end saved nearly 14% before we even touched print specs. Here’s a simple example from a factory floor visit in Guangdong. Two mailer boxes had the same outer dimensions: 10 x 8 x 4 inches. One used single-color black print on kraft with no coating. The other used four-color process print, aqueous coating, and a custom insert. On paper the difference looked minor. In production, the second box required more press time, more drying, and extra QC at the packing table. The quote gap was over 27%. Same footprint. Very different economics. Product Details: What Your Supplier Should Offer
A practical packaging cost supplier guide should not stop at price. It should tell you what product types a supplier can actually manufacture, because capability affects both cost and risk. The core range usually includes folding cartons, rigid boxes, mailer boxes, corrugated shipping boxes, paper bags, and inserts. Each one serves a different purpose, and each one carries its own production logic, from the paper mill in Zhejiang to the die-cutting room in Dongguan and the packing station where the final cartons are counted and bundled.
Folding cartons are ideal for retail packaging, cosmetics, supplements, and small consumer goods. They are efficient to ship flat and print well on coated or uncoated paperboard, especially on materials like 350gsm C1S artboard or 300gsm SBS board. Rigid boxes suit premium product packaging such as watches, fragrance, and gifts, where presentation matters as much as protection. Mailer boxes are common for e-commerce and subscription packaging because they ship flat, assemble quickly, and give you a broad panel for package branding. Corrugated shipping boxes are the workhorses when protection matters more than shelf presence, often specified in ECT-32 or ECT-44 depending on pallet load and transit conditions.
There is also a practical difference between standard packaging and fully custom packaging. Standard structures with custom print often mean lower MOQ, faster sampling, and less tooling. Fully custom packaging can be the right move, but it usually increases die charges and engineering time. In a supplier meeting in Ningbo last year, a subscription brand wanted a unique five-sided tray-and-sleeve system. Nice idea. Expensive reality. We walked them back to a standard mailer with a printed insert, and the launch kept the same visual impact while cutting tooling cost by 22%. The marketing team sighed, the budget team smiled, and everyone pretended they had planned it that way from the beginning.
Customization options matter, but not every feature adds equal value. Size changes affect freight and fit. Embossing and foil stamping add strong shelf appeal, but they also increase setup and reject risk on the line. Window cutouts can help buyers show the product inside, though they create another fabrication step at the die-cutting stage. Water-based coatings, recycled content, and FSC-certified board can support sustainability claims, but they may affect lead time and price depending on mill availability and whether the stock is coming from a paper supplier in Guangzhou or a board converter in Suzhou. Specifications That Change Packaging Cost
The fastest way to control cost is to lock down specifications early. A strong packaging cost supplier guide depends on exact dimensions, board caliper, GSM, print method, coating type, and tolerance level. If you send a vague request for “a medium-size custom box,” you will get a vague quote. If you send a dimension like 9.5 x 6.25 x 2.5 inches, material target, and decoration details, the supplier can price the job accurately and compare options more honestly. I have seen the same box quoted three different ways because one buyer wrote “beauty carton” and another wrote “350gsm C1S folding carton with matte aqueous coating,” and only one of those gave the factory enough information to calculate yield correctly.
Dimensions affect more than fit. They affect board yield, carton nesting, palletization, and freight efficiency. An oversized box wastes material. An undersized box risks damage and returns. I’ve seen a beverage client in Southern California shave 0.4 inches off box height and save enough board on a six-figure order to offset the cost of upgraded print. That is the kind of move a packaging cost supplier guide should encourage: precision that lowers waste and protects margin. On the factory side, even a small change in width can alter how many blanks fit on a 1050 x 750 mm press layout, which is exactly where cost begins to drift.
Board caliper and GSM matter because they define strength and feel. A 300gsm paperboard carton might work for lightweight beauty items, while a heavier product may need a 400gsm board or a corrugated insert. If you go too light, the box collapses in transit. Too heavy, and unit cost rises without adding useful value. This is one reason packaging engineering is not guesswork. It is closer to recipe development than a shopping list, and if one ingredient is off, the whole thing behaves differently. In a plant near Suzhou, a change from 300gsm to 350gsm once added enough stiffness to cut carton deformation complaints by half, even though the board cost only rose modestly.
Print method changes the economics too. Digital print works well for short runs and fast sampling because setup is lighter, but the unit price often stays higher on larger quantities. Offset print usually makes more sense on higher volumes because setup costs spread across more units. If you are evaluating a supplier, ask where the break-even point sits. For one beauty client ordering 2,000 units, digital made sense; at 10,000 units, offset dropped the cost enough to justify the plate charge. That one question can save days of confusion and thousands in unnecessary spend.
Coating type is another quiet cost driver. Gloss lamination can raise visual impact. Matte lamination gives a more restrained premium look. Soft-touch feels upscale but adds labor and material cost. Aqueous coating is often a sensible middle ground for retail packaging because it protects print without the higher price of film lamination. The right choice depends on the brand, shelf life, and handling conditions. Sustainability specs deserve a practical read, not a marketing one. If you want FSC-certified board, ask whether the mill chain is documented. If you want recycled content, ask for the percentage and whether it affects print brightness or stiffness. If you want water-based inks, ask how that changes drying time and color range. For buyers who need an external reference, the FSC site is a useful authority on certification, while the EPA sustainable materials guidance helps frame broader materials choices. In practice, I’ve seen FSC paper from a mill in Hebei add only a modest premium on one order and a much larger one on another, depending on whether the stock was already in the supplier’s inventory.
Spec mistakes create hidden costs in three places. First, damage: the wrong board or structure increases breakage. Second, returns: poor fit leads to customer complaints. Third, packing speed: awkward inserts or flimsy cartons slow down fulfillment staff. One warehouse manager in New Jersey told me his team lost 18 seconds per unit on a poorly designed insert because the product snagged during packing. Multiply that across 20,000 units, and the operational cost is real. Packaging Cost Supplier Guide: Pricing, MOQ, and Quotes
Pricing is where most buyers get stuck, and a solid packaging cost supplier guide should make the quote structure visible. Most suppliers price packaging using a mix of unit cost, tooling or die charges, sampling, setup fees, finishing costs, and freight. If you only compare the unit number, you are not comparing actual offers. You are comparing fragments. That’s like judging a restaurant by the price of bread and ignoring the actual meal, which is how bad procurement stories get made in conference rooms from Chicago to Shanghai.
A quote should show the exact size, material, print method, coating, MOQ, and Incoterms or freight terms. If one supplier quotes EXW and another includes delivered freight, the numbers are not directly comparable. The same goes for sampling. One supplier may include one prototype round, while another charges separately for each revision. That difference alone can change your project budget by a few hundred dollars before production starts. I’ve seen a prototype in Dongguan cost $85 and a second proof revision add another $60, which felt small until three departments each requested a change.
MOQ is the next major variable. Lower MOQ helps testing and reduces inventory risk, especially for new product launches. Higher MOQ usually lowers unit cost because the supplier spreads setup work across more units. Low MOQ is not automatically best. If you reorder quickly, the premium for a small run can be more expensive than carrying a slightly larger inventory. The right answer depends on velocity, shelf life, and forecast confidence, and it is common for a packaging factory in Foshan to price 1,000 units at a noticeably higher per-unit rate than 5,000 units because setup cost is fixed.
In one client call, a skincare brand in Los Angeles wanted a 500-unit pilot because they were unsure of demand. We priced that against 2,500 units. The smaller run had a unit cost about 31% higher, but the total cash exposure was lower. They took the pilot, sold through in six weeks, and then placed a larger reorder with better confidence. Process and Timeline: From Quote to Delivery
The workflow should be predictable, and a useful packaging cost supplier guide should lay it out clearly. The standard path is inquiry, specification review, quote, sampling, approval, production, quality control, and shipping. Each step has a delay risk, and most delays come from incomplete artwork or changes after proof approval. On a well-run job in Shenzhen, that sequence can stay tight, but even then one missing Pantone reference or a late dieline revision can add days immediately.
Artwork readiness matters more than many buyers assume. If your dieline is wrong by even 2 mm, the proof cycle can stretch. If your logo is not supplied as vector art, the design team may need to rebuild it. If your Pantone reference is unclear, color matching takes another round. I’ve seen a launch slip by eight business days because a client uploaded a low-resolution JPEG for a foil stamp. That was avoidable. It was also the kind of mistake that makes everyone stare at the screen in silence for a few seconds, because nobody wants to say, “We are here because of a tiny blurry file.”
Sampling usually takes less time than full production, but it still needs planning. A prototype or pre-production sample can often move in 5 to 10 business days depending on complexity. Production after approval might take 12 to 20 business days for standard custom packaging, longer for rigid boxes or heavy finishing. Freight can add several days by air or several weeks by ocean. A serious packaging cost supplier guide should force that timeline conversation early, not after the PO is issued. For example, a carton order in Guangdong with matte lamination and foil stamping may need 15 business days after proof approval before it is ready to ship, especially if the finishing line is backed up.
Communication checkpoints matter. Buyers should expect updates at proof approval, material procurement, pre-production, and packing completion. If the supplier goes quiet for several days during any of those stages, ask for a status report. One warehouse planner I worked with in New Jersey always asked for photo confirmation before dispatch. That practice saved him from receiving 2,000 cartons with the wrong gloss finish. Photos are not optional when the cost of a mistake is a full reprint, and a factory in Foshan can usually send packing photos the same day if the project manager is paying attention.
Plan launch dates with a buffer. I recommend holding at least 10 business days of slack between the expected arrival date and the product launch date for standard freight, and more if the shipment crosses customs. Reorders should be triggered before you hit the last 20% of inventory, especially for branded packaging with a longer lead time. Emergency shipping almost always costs more than the original packaging budget. A shipment from Shenzhen to Los Angeles by air can add hundreds of dollars per pallet compared with ocean freight, which is why the calendar matters as much as the carton.
